Output 5c8c5291bb17ee679434eb50808d8d54386803c1929c683cdbae0292bc7bc0c6:4

value
64304436
script pubkey
OP_0 OP_PUSHBYTES_20 cfa8223c37b4022336dec13758868de140cb26ac
address
bc1qe75zy0phkspzxdk7cym43p5du9qvkf4v5ua25k
transaction
5c8c5291bb17ee679434eb50808d8d54386803c1929c683cdbae0292bc7bc0c6
spent
true